The OneCoin cryptocurrency scam became notorious with its sheer size – between April 2014 and March 2018 it had attracted over 4 billion USD. Consequently, the victims of the scam sued Konstantin Ignatov, one of the now convicted perpetrators.
A settlement was reached in that lawsuit after Donald Berdeaux and Christine Grablis, who represent all scammed investors, agreed to it because US court judge warned them that the case could be dismissed if they failed to provide details showing the reasons not to abandon a class- action lawsuit.
Constantin Ignatov is currently negotiating with US prosecutors about a plea deal after testifying against an accomplice of his and is still awaiting sentencing.
